[gentoo-commits] gentoo-x86 commit in net-wireless/airtraf: ChangeLog

2014-07-19 Thread Jeroen Roovers (jer)
jer 14/07/19 12:30:30

  Modified: ChangeLog
  Log:
  Fix patch.
  
  (Portage version: 2.2.10/cvs/Linux x86_64, signed Manifest commit with key 
A792A613)

Revision  ChangesPath
1.21 net-wireless/airtraf/ChangeLog

file :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?rev=1.21&view=markup
plain: 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?rev=1.21&content-type=text/plain
diff :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?r1=1.20&r2=1.21

Index: ChangeLog
===
RCS file: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v
retrieving revision 1.20
retrieving revision 1.21
diff -u -r1.20 -r1.21
--- ChangeLog   19 Jul 2014 12:26:37 -  1.20
+++ ChangeLog   19 Jul 2014 12:30:30 -  1.21
@@ -1,6 +1,9 @@
 # ChangeLog for net-wireless/airtraf
 #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v 1.20 
2014/07/19 12:26:37 jer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v 1.21 
2014/07/19 12:30:30 jer Exp $
+
+  19 Jul 2014; Jeroen Roovers  files/airtraf-1.1.patch:
+  Fix patch.
 
 *airtraf-1.1-r2 (19 Jul 2014)
 






[gentoo-commits] gentoo-x86 commit in net-wireless/airtraf: ChangeLog airtraf-1.1.ebuild

2015-02-22 Thread Jeroen Roovers (jer)
jer 15/02/22 08:26:58

  Modified: ChangeLog
  Removed:  airtraf-1.1.ebuild
  Log:
  Old.
  
  (Portage version: 2.2.17/cvs/Linux x86_64, signed Manifest commit with key 
A792A613)

Revision  ChangesPath
1.26 net-wireless/airtraf/ChangeLog

file :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?rev=1.26&view=markup
plain: 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?rev=1.26&content-type=text/plain
diff :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?r1=1.25&r2=1.26

Index: ChangeLog
===
RCS file: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v
retrieving revision 1.25
retrieving revision 1.26
diff -u -r1.25 -r1.26
--- ChangeLog   21 Feb 2015 12:24:15 -  1.25
+++ ChangeLog   22 Feb 2015 08:26:58 -  1.26
@@ -1,6 +1,9 @@
 # ChangeLog for net-wireless/airtraf
 #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v 1.25 
2015/02/21 12:24:15 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v 1.26 
2015/02/22 08:26:58 jer Exp $
+
+  22 Feb 2015; Jeroen Roovers  -airtraf-1.1.ebuild:
+  Old.
 
   21 Feb 2015; Agostino Sarubbo  airtraf-1.1-r3.ebuild:
   Stable for ppc, wrt bug #539202






[gentoo-commits] gentoo-x86 commit in net-wireless/airtraf: ChangeLog airtraf-1.1-r1.ebuild metadata.xml

2014-07-18 Thread Jeroen Roovers (jer)
jer 14/07/18 21:54:58

  Modified: ChangeLog airtraf-1.1-r1.ebuild metadata.xml
  Log:
  EAPI bump. List sys-libs/ncurses dependency and fix building against 
sys-libs/ncurses[tinfo].
  
  (Portage version: 2.2.10/cvs/Linux x86_64, signed Manifest commit with key 
A792A613)

Revision  ChangesPath
1.19 net-wireless/airtraf/ChangeLog

file :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?rev=1.19&view=markup
plain: 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?rev=1.19&content-type=text/plain
diff :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?r1=1.18&r2=1.19

Index: ChangeLog
===
RCS file: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v
retrieving revision 1.18
retrieving revision 1.19
diff -u -r1.18 -r1.19
--- ChangeLog   20 Aug 2011 21:05:36 -  1.18
+++ ChangeLog   18 Jul 2014 21:54:58 -  1.19
@@ -1,6 +1,11 @@
 # ChangeLog for net-wireless/airtraf
-#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v 1.18 
2011/08/20 21:05:36 jer Exp $
+#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v 1.19 
2014/07/18 21:54:58 jer Exp $
+
+  18 Jul 2014; Jeroen Roovers  airtraf-1.1-r1.ebuild,
+  metadata.xml:
+  EAPI bump. List sys-libs/ncurses dependency and fix building against
+  sys-libs/ncurses[tinfo].
 
   20 Aug 2011; Jeroen Roovers  metadata.xml:
   Remove useless maintainer tag.



1.3  net-wireless/airtraf/airtraf-1.1-r1.ebuild

file :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/airtraf-1.1-r1.ebuild?rev=1.3&view=markup
plain: 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/airtraf-1.1-r1.ebuild?rev=1.3&content-type=text/plain
diff :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/airtraf-1.1-r1.ebuild?r1=1.2&r2=1.3

Index: airtraf-1.1-r1.ebuild
===
RCS file: /var/cvsroot/gentoo-x86/net-wireless/airtraf/airtraf-1.1-r1.ebuild,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-r1.2 -r1.3
--- airtraf-1.1-r1.ebuild   17 Sep 2010 03:28:08 -  1.2
+++ airtraf-1.1-r1.ebuild   18 Jul 2014 21:54:58 -  1.3
@@ -1,26 +1,36 @@
-# Copyright 1999-2010 Gentoo Foundation
+# Copyright 1999-2014 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: 
/var/cvsroot/gentoo-x86/net-wireless/airtraf/airtraf-1.1-r1.ebuild,v 1.2 
2010/09/17 03:28:08 jer Exp $
+# $Header: 
/var/cvsroot/gentoo-x86/net-wireless/airtraf/airtraf-1.1-r1.ebuild,v 1.3 
2014/07/18 21:54:58 jer Exp $
 
-EAPI="2"
+EAPI=5
 
 inherit eutils toolchain-funcs
 
 DESCRIPTION="AirTraf 802.11b Wireless traffic sniffer"
+LICENSE="GPL-2"
 HOMEPAGE="http://www.elixar.com/";
-SRC_URI="http://www.elixar.com/${P}.tar.gz";
-
-IUSE=""
-
+SRC_URI="${HOMEPAGE}${P}.tar.gz"
 SLOT="0"
-LICENSE="GPL-2"
 KEYWORDS="~amd64 ~ppc ~x86"
 
-DEPEND="net-libs/libpcap"
-RDEPEND="${DEPEND}"
+RDEPEND="
+   net-libs/libpcap
+   sys-libs/ncurses
+"
+DEPEND="
+   ${RDEPEND}
+   virtual/pkgconfig
+"
 
 src_prepare() {
epatch "${FILESDIR}"/${P}.patch
+   sed -i \
+   -e '/^LIBS/s|=.*|= $(shell $(PKG_CONFIG) --libs panel)|' \
+   src/libncurses/Makefile || die
+   sed -i \
+   -e 's|-lpanel -lncurses|$(shell $(PKG_CONFIG) --libs panel)|' \
+   src/sniffd/Makefile || die
+   tc-export PKG_CONFIG
 }
 
 src_compile() {
@@ -35,6 +45,6 @@
 }
 
 src_install () {
-   dobin src/airtraf || die
-   newdoc docs/airtraf_doc.html airtraf_documentation.html
+   dobin src/airtraf
+   dodoc Authors COMPATIBILITY docs/airtraf_doc.html
 }



1.4  net-wireless/airtraf/metadata.xml

file :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/metadata.xml?rev=1.4&view=markup
plain: 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/metadata.xml?rev=1.4&content-type=text/plain
diff :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/metadata.xml?r1=1.3&r2=1.4

Index: metadata.xml
===
RCS file: /var/cvsroot/gentoo-x86/net-wireless/airtraf/metadata.xml,v
retrieving revision 1.3
retrieving revision 1.4
diff -u -r1.3 -r1.4
--- metadata.xml20 Aug 2011 21:05:36 -  1.3
+++ metadata.xml18 Jul 2014 21:54:58 -  1.4
@@ -2,9 +2,11 @@
 http://www.gentoo.org/dtd/metadata.dtd";>
 
 netmon
-AirTraf 1.0 is a wireless sniffer that can detect and 
determine exactly 
-what is being transmitted over 802.11 wireless networks. This open-source 
program tracks 
-and i

[gentoo-commits] gentoo-x86 commit in net-wireless/airtraf: ChangeLog airtraf-1.1-r3.ebuild airtraf-1.1-r2.ebuild

2015-02-07 Thread Jeroen Roovers (jer)
jer 15/02/08 07:52:52

  Modified: ChangeLog
  Added:airtraf-1.1-r3.ebuild
  Removed:  airtraf-1.1-r2.ebuild
  Log:
  Fix fprintf()s with missing format argument (bug #539228).
  
  (Portage version: 2.2.15/cvs/Linux x86_64, RepoMan options: --force, signed 
Manifest commit with key A792A613)

Revision  ChangesPath
1.23 net-wireless/airtraf/ChangeLog

file :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?rev=1.23&view=markup
plain: 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?rev=1.23&content-type=text/plain
diff :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/ChangeLog?r1=1.22&r2=1.23

Index: ChangeLog
===
RCS file: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v
retrieving revision 1.22
retrieving revision 1.23
diff -u -r1.22 -r1.23
--- ChangeLog   7 Feb 2015 13:29:38 -   1.22
+++ ChangeLog   8 Feb 2015 07:52:52 -   1.23
@@ -1,6 +1,12 @@
 # ChangeLog for net-wireless/airtraf
 #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v 1.22 
2015/02/07 13:29:38 ago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-wireless/airtraf/ChangeLog,v 1.23 
2015/02/08 07:52:52 jer Exp $
+
+*airtraf-1.1-r3 (08 Feb 2015)
+
+  08 Feb 2015; Jeroen Roovers  -airtraf-1.1-r2.ebuild,
+  +airtraf-1.1-r3.ebuild, +files/airtraf-1.1-fprintf-format.patch:
+  Fix fprintf()s with missing format argument (bug #539228).
 
   07 Feb 2015; Agostino Sarubbo  airtraf-1.1-r2.ebuild:
   Stable for amd64, wrt bug #539202



1.1  net-wireless/airtraf/airtraf-1.1-r3.ebuild

file : 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/airtraf-1.1-r3.ebuild?rev=1.1&view=markup
plain: 
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-wireless/airtraf/airtraf-1.1-r3.ebuild?rev=1.1&content-type=text/plain

Index: airtraf-1.1-r3.ebuild
===
# Copyright 1999-2015 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/net-wireless/airtraf/airtraf-1.1-r3.ebuild,v 
1.1 2015/02/08 07:52:52 jer Exp $

EAPI=5

inherit eutils toolchain-funcs

DESCRIPTION="AirTraf 802.11b Wireless traffic sniffer"
LICENSE="GPL-2"
HOMEPAGE="http://www.elixar.com/";
SRC_URI="${HOMEPAGE}${P}.tar.gz"
SLOT="0"
KEYWORDS="amd64 ~ppc ~x86"

RDEPEND="
net-libs/libpcap
sys-libs/ncurses
"
DEPEND="
${RDEPEND}
virtual/pkgconfig
"

src_prepare() {
epatch \
"${FILESDIR}"/${P}.patch \
"${FILESDIR}"/${P}-off-by-one.patch \
"${FILESDIR}"/${P}-fprintf-format.patch

sed -i \
-e '/^LIBS/s|=.*|= $(shell $(PKG_CONFIG) --libs panel)|' \
src/libncurses/Makefile || die
sed -i \
-e 's|-lpanel -lncurses|$(shell $(PKG_CONFIG) --libs panel)|' \
src/sniffd/Makefile || die
tc-export PKG_CONFIG
}

src_compile() {
# parallel make (bug #297331)
emake -C src -j1 \
CC=$(tc-getCC) \
CXX=$(tc-getCXX) \
CFLAGS="${CFLAGS}" \
CXXFLAGS="${CXXFLAGS}" \
LDFLAGS="${LDFLAGS}" \
|| die
}

src_install () {
dobin src/airtraf
dodoc Authors COMPATIBILITY docs/airtraf_doc.html
}